Take a screenshot of a specific part of the screen. Taking a screenshot is all well and good, but more often than not you don’t actually need the whole screen in the capture. On Macs there’s a simple way to grab just the part of the screen you want: Cmd + Shift + 4. flea\u0027s h7WebUse your Mac with other Apple devices.
